Transaction 74d721c1a1a5f84c72c36e7288f96bd9e779e08521e8c593fe4e34a2e6e519ae

1 Input
2 Outputs
  • 74d721c1a1a5f84c72c36e7288f96bd9e779e08521e8c593fe4e34a2e6e519ae:0
  • value  4500439443
    address  3QEkFaHPGSRGvc3d21EFQRSaUzbPgknS7e
  • 74d721c1a1a5f84c72c36e7288f96bd9e779e08521e8c593fe4e34a2e6e519ae:1
  • value  500000000
    address  3FT3q8rJPmaPXYuKeTuj2PtrFh2G5P1NzL